Etiketler
PL-SQL fonksiyonlarından NVL() ve DECODE() u kodlama sırasında getirdiği kolaylıklar ile bizi IF_ELSE yada CASE-WHEN bloklarından kurtarmaktadır. İki String alanı birleştirmek için kullanılan bir başka PL-SQL fonksiyonu da CONCAT() dir.
concat( string1, string2 ) as String 3
concat(“Mehmet” , ” ÖZAKAN”) = Mehmet ÖZAKAN sonucunu döndürür. Eğer birden fazla alanı (string olması önemli değil) birleştirmek istiyorsanız || sembolunu kullanabilirsiniz.
TEL_ULKE_KODU || TEL_BOLGE_KODU || TEL = TelefonNumarasi gibi.
Bu konu ile ilgili aşağıdaki yazıları okumanızı tavsiye ederim.
- PL-SQL (ORACLE) Fonksiyonları / Decode, NVL, NVL2
- ORACLE FUNCTIONS – CONCAT ve ||
- ORACLE FUNCTIONS – SUBSTR
- PL-SQL (ORACLE) Fonksiyonları – WM_CONCAT – Satırları Birleştirmek
Teknik seviyesi biraz daha yüksek yazılar okuman isterseniz aşağıdaki yazılara göz atabilirsiniz.
Geri bildirim: PL-SQL (ORACLE) Fonksiyonları – SUBSTR « Mehmet Özakan
Geri bildirim: PL-SQL (ORACLE) Fonksiyonları | Decode, NVL, NVL2 « Mehmet Özakan
Geri bildirim: PL-SQL (ORACLE) Fonksiyonları – WM_CONCAT – Satırları Birleştirmek « Mehmet Özakan